+ Journal of Pharmacy Research - Portulaca Oleracea (Purslane) Review

Conclusion: The extensive survey of literature revealed that Portulaca oleracea, is an important medicinal plant with diverse pharmacological spectrum. Due to its high content of nutrients, especially antioxidants (vitamins A and C, á- tocopherol, â-carotene, glutathione) and omega-3 fatty acids, and its wound healing and antimicrobial effects as well as its traditional use in the topical

treatment of inflammatory conditions, purslane is a highly likely candidate as a useful cosmetic ingredient. Since most of the reported effects of purslane are due to its fresh juice or to its decoction, water extractives would be most suitable. Further evaluation needs to be carried out in order to explore the concealed areas and their practical clinical applications, which can be used for the welfare of the mankind.

+ Indian Journal of Medical Research and Pharmaceutical Sciences - A review study with anti-inflammatory and muscle relaxant perspective

Conclusion: Portulaca Oleracea was shown that its anti-inflammatory effect is mostly due to the presence of Oleracone A,oleracone B. Among its -carboline , the two first was diagnosed to be responsible for its anti-inflammatory effect .The relaxant activity of Portulaca oleracea is due to Postsynaptic alpha-adrenoceptors, inhibition of trans-membrane Ca influx, potassium ions, Ca2+ mobilization, and K+ ion.Portulaca also possesses some of the claimed traditional uses of the wild species in the relief of pain and inflammation. In this study Anti-inflammatory and relaxant properties of this plant are presented using published articles in scientific sites.

+ International Journal of Science and Research (IJSR)

It is quite evident from this review that Portulaca oleracea (purslane) contains a number of phytoconstituents, which reveal its use for various cosmetics purposes. Presence of high content of antioxidants (vitamins A and C, alphatocopherol, beta-carotene) and omega-3 fatty acids and its wound healing and antimicrobial effects as well as its traditional use in the topical treatment of inflammatory conditions suggest that purslane is a highly likely candidate as a useful cosmetic ingredient and in pharmacy
